Transaction d81cc4742ea2415f1bfed3990186f2d1f1727c5b24f6045c8d1e2bc3ada06aab
1 Input
1 Output
-
d81cc4742ea2415f1bfed3990186f2d1f1727c5b24f6045c8d1e2bc3ada06aab:0
- value
- 22206421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2106095f053e84b955ba43ee5e567612873588c5 OP_EQUAL
- address
- 34hdTJdxTXiXGYEwkjTk6SY73UrRA3pbWx